I thank you for following along in the sing-through of Carl Sandburg's 1927 American Songbag--over 300 songs. But the pandemic is still going on so I'm going to continue.

Next I'm going to sing through Carl Sandburg's 1950 NEW AMERICAN SONGBAG. About 40% of the NEW AMERICAN SONGBAG
are reprints from the 1927 Songbag, and I will not rerecord them. But that still leaves a number of great songs Sandburg collected.

I hope to continue recording as long as I am able (knock on wood) and would like to sing-through SWEET MUSIC a songbook from Sandburg's daughter, Helga, collecting songs the family sang together in the evenings.

In the future I'd also like to explore other songs collected by Sandburg found among his papers at the Rare Book and Manuscripts library located at the University of Illinois Champaign-Urbana. Then possibly proceed to the Lomax songbooks.
